Our house was built in 1936, the top of our chimney was crumbling, and some mortar between the bricks was deteriorating. The guys did a good job removing and pouring a new crown on top and re grouting the brick underneath. There was also a 2nd flu inside the chimney that wasn't being used anymore (from an old oil burning furnace) and they capped that off for us.

Dobson did some work for me, a few years back. It took months to get an appointment with them. I originally called them to have my chimney re-flashed. They came out and quoted me, for what I thought was re-grouting the chimney, that I did not ask for and flashing. After said work was done, the chimney was not re-flashed. I called and asked why it was not re-flashed and the person I spoke with acted like he didn't know what I was talking about. So they sent a younger guy out to re-flash the chimney and charged me more money. So what I initially thought was gonna cost me like $400 for the re-flashing actually cost me about $2800. All for a chimney that's not being used for heating. The $2800 flashing looks horrible. I would not do business with them again!
